The week of Christmas is usually the busiest times at all the parks. I would expect wall-to-wall people. As for booking a room, there may still be some available, but I would expect to pay $250-$300 a night.

Grinchmas occurs from November 23 to December 31.

As for discounts, keep an eye out on these boards. When someone finds a good deal, they are bound to post it! :)
